it has been told earlier (at least by me), SSLv3 in the logs means
nothing. It might be deceiving, but those lines aren't telling the
TLS version being used.

The hint indicating it is where it says "TLS_[version] ciphersuite:".

On that log it doesn't even appear because they couldn't even
negotiate them.
